4-Day Honeymoon Itinerary in Hyderabad, India

Friday, October 27, 2023: Arrival and Romantic Dinner

Welcome to Hyderabad! Start your romantic journey by checking into a luxurious hotel and freshening up. In the morning, visit the iconic Charminar, a magnificent monument offering panoramic views of the city. Explore the nearby market, Laad Bazaar, where you can buy traditional bangles and local handicrafts.

In the afternoon, indulge in a couple's massage and pampering session at a spa to relax and rejuvenate. As the evening sets in, head to the famous Shilparamam Arts & Crafts village for a romantic walk amidst beautiful sculptures and ethnic shops. End the day with a candlelit dinner at a romantic rooftop restaurant, savoring delicious local cuisine.

  • Charminar & Laad Bazaar: Estimated Cost - INR 100,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Spa Treatment: Estimated Cost - INR 5,000,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Shilparamam Arts & Crafts Village: Estimated Cost - INR 200 for entry,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Romantic Rooftop Dinner: Estimated Cost - INR 2,500,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
Saturday, October 28, 2023: Historical Exploration

Discover the rich history of Hyderabad today. Begin your morning by visiting the magnificent Golconda Fort, an imposing structure with stunning architecture and breathtaking views. Explore the Qutb Shahi Tombs, showcasing the grandeur of the Qutb Shahi dynasty.

In the afternoon, visit the iconic Chowmahalla Palace, a former seat of power adorned with opulent architecture and beautiful gardens. Enjoy a traditional Hyderabadi lunch at a local restaurant, savoring biryanis and delectable regional dishes.

In the evening, take a romantic boat ride on the enchanting Hussain Sagar Lake, admiring the picturesque Buddha statue standing in the middle. Spend a romantic evening at the Lumbini Park, strolling along the beautifully illuminated pathways and enjoying musical fountain shows.

  • Golconda Fort: Estimated Cost - INR 50, Time Spent - 3-4 hours
  • Qutb Shahi Tombs: Estimated Cost - INR 20,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Chowmahalla Palace: Estimated Cost - INR 80,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Hyderabadi Lunch: Estimated Cost - INR 800,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Romantic Boat Ride & Lumbini Park: Estimated Cost - INR 200,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
Sunday, October 29, 2023: Cultural Immersion

Immerse yourself in the vibrant culture of Hyderabad on this day. Start your morning by exploring the Salar Jung Museum, one of the largest art museums in the world, housing unique collections from different civilizations.

In the afternoon, visit the beautiful Qutub Shahi Heritage Park, containing royal tombs and lush gardens. Experience the graceful art of Kuchipudi, a traditional dance form, by attending a live performance in the evening.

  • Salar Jung Museum: Estimated Cost - INR 150, Time Spent - 3-4 hours
  • Qutub Shahi Heritage Park: Estimated Cost - INR 50,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Kuchipudi Dance Performance: Estimated Cost - INR 500,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
Monday, October 30, 2023: Relaxation and Farewell

On your last day, take some time to relax and unwind. Start your morning with a visit to the soothing Birla Mandir, a beautiful Hindu temple made of pure white marble. Enjoy a peaceful walk in the surrounding gardens.

In the afternoon, explore the scenic beauty of Ramoji Film City, the world's largest integrated film studio. Take a guided tour to witness the sets of famous movies and experience behind-the-scenes magic.

End your honeymoon on a high note with a romantic dinner cruise on the Musi River, enjoying the city's sparkling lights reflecting on the water and the soothing breeze. Say farewell to Hyderabad with beautiful memories.

  • Birla Mandir: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Ramoji Film City: Estimated Cost - INR 2,500, Time Spent - 4-5 hours
  • Romantic Dinner Cruise: Estimated Cost - INR 2,000, Time Spent - 2-3 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For off the beaten path attractions, explore the lesser-known Paigah Tombs, a remarkable structure showcasing the architectural marvel of the Paigah nobles. Take a peaceful walk at the picturesque Durgam Cheruvu, also known as the Secret Lake.

Locals love visiting the famous Paradise Biryani for its mouthwatering biryanis and the Chowmahalla Palace for its serene ambiance. The bustling Nampally Market is a favorite among locals for shopping traditional clothing and handicrafts.
